AEW World Champion makes surprise appearance at DEFY show in Seattle

AEW World Champion Swerve Strickland made a surprise appearance at Friday night’s DEFY Here And Now event, which took place at the Washington Hall in Seattle, WA.

Strickland told the fans DEFY is special, as it was a big part of his journey in becoming the first-ever black AEW World Champion, after defeating Samoa Joe at Dynasty back on April 21 at the Chaifetz Arena in St. Louis, Missouri.

He also talked about how he and WWE Undisputed Champion Cody Rhodes wrestled in the main event of the first ever DEFY show. Strickland then gave a big shout-out to Rhodes and also praised the DEFY roster.

Strickland, who is from near-by Tacoma, did a free meet-and-greet after the show. He is also a three-time DEFY World Champion and a DEFY Tag Team Champion.
